What makes it 88% Kids-Friendly: Children enjoy fenced nature playgrounds, sand-water zones, open lawns and $9 miniature trains; shaded tables and toilets exist, but parents must pack meals as no café operates.
Why 2-3 hours visit duration is ideal for with kids: A family can explore the playground, creek and enjoy a picnic without rushing.
Nature-based playground:
Two play zones feature sand-and-water tables, basket swings, bucket-seat flying fox and accessible carousel.
Tip: Bring spare clothes and shoes for water play and use the free Magical Park AR app for extra fun.
Creek exploration & treasure hunt:
Kids can wade in shallow stretches of Christies Creek and search for smooth stones and birds.
Tip: Pack towels, water shoes and a simple nature checklist for a self-guided treasure hunt.
Miniature train rides:
Ride the Morphett Vale Railway’s small steam/diesel train on the 2nd & 4th Sunday of each month.
Tip: Buy tickets (AUD 9pp) early after 1 pm and check the city events page for schedule updates.
Picnic & ball games:
Use shaded shelters with BBQs or spread a blanket on the open turf for family games.
Tip: Bring picnic supplies, a ball or kite and refill water bottles at the drinking fountains.

In summer, visit early morning and bring sun protection. In cooler months, skip water play and enjoy extra bike rides. Check for free “Trucks on Tour” events on select Sundays.
